| Description | Siena AI is an autonomous AI customer service platform specifically designed for commerce businesses. It deploys empathic, human-like AI agents across multiple channels, automating customer interactions from routine inquiries to complex problem-solving. The platform aims to significantly reduce operational costs, enhance customer satisfaction through personalized service, and drive additional revenue by leveraging AI for proactive engagement and sales opportunities. It provides a scalable solution for modern customer experience challenges in retail and e-commerce, ensuring businesses can deliver exceptional service around the clock. Siena AI transforms customer service into a strategic asset for growth and efficiency. | Sourcery Sentinel, more commonly known as Sourcery, is an advanced AI agent specifically engineered to enhance Python code quality, prevent bugs, and streamline development workflows. It integrates deeply into a developer's IDE and CI/CD pipelines, offering real-time refactoring suggestions and automated code reviews. By focusing on continuous improvement and reducing technical debt, Sourcery empowers developers and teams to maintain robust, clean, and efficient codebases, significantly boosting productivity and code reliability. |
| What It Does | Siena AI deploys sophisticated AI agents that understand customer intent, sentiment, and context to provide natural, human-like responses. It integrates with existing commerce systems and knowledge bases to autonomously resolve customer issues and handle inquiries across channels like web chat, email, and social media. The platform learns and adapts, continuously improving its ability to deliver personalized, efficient, and revenue-driving customer service experiences without requiring constant human oversight. | Sourcery analyzes Python code in real-time, providing intelligent suggestions for refactoring, bug prevention, and code quality improvements directly within the developer's integrated development environment. It also integrates with version control systems to automate code reviews during pull requests, ensuring consistent adherence to coding standards and best practices across the entire team's codebase. |
